Honey heating effect on the diastase activity was studied in two steps. Heating was carried out in the transient heating step, with final temperatures between 60 and 100 °C and 14 s elapsed time, and in the isothermal ...

WebFeb 8, 2024 · The provisions of EU Directive 2001/110/EC on honey require, with certain derogations inapplicable here, a product described as honey to exhibit a diastase activity (number, DN) of not less than 8 DN. WebApr 22, 2024 · Diastase is an enzyme that is found naturally in honey and degrades over time, especially when exposed to heat. This number expresses the diastase activity as ml 1 percent starch solution hydrolysed by the enzyme in 1 g of honey in 1 h at 40 0 C. This diastase number corresponds with the Gothe-scale number.
